The American Buffalo

The American Buffalo - PBS

PBS

Docuseries

2023

TV14

Documentary

Tracing the near demise and ultimate return of the American buffalo.

Where to Stream

2023– Docuseries 1 Season8 Episodes

Upcoming TV Airings

2023– Docuseries 1 Season8 Episodes

Sorry, this show is not airing on television in the next two weeks. Check back again soon!

News aboutThe American Buffalo